Mesothelioma Lawyers

The law firm you choose to handle your mesothelioma or asbestos trust fund claim is vital. A national law firm is well-versed in litigating mesothelioma cases and asbestos trust fund claims across the country.

Mesothelioma lawyers at top firms combine their knowledge of the law with compassion and concern for their clients. They make the process of filing a lawsuit as simple as is possible for the families of patients.

They work on a contingency Basis

When an asbestos-related victim is diagnosed with mesothelioma or another asbestos-related illness the family as well as the victim have to deal with a variety of issues. A mesothelioma lawyer (click home page) can ease the burden of the family members of victims by aiding them to understand their legal options, and help them navigate the complex legal system.

The most effective mesothelioma lawyers are experienced and dedicated to helping their clients and families get compensation. They are experts in filing a lawsuit, conducting an investigation into the client’s exposure to asbestos, taking depositions and arguing their case at trial.

Mesothelioma lawsuits are complex and require extensive resources and research to be successful. Mesothelioma lawyers also can connect their clients to world-class doctors and medical professionals to treat their asbestos attorneys-related ailments.

Asbestos victims and their families may be entitled to compensation from asbestos companies who are negligent. Compensation can help pay for medical expenses or cover debts, and ensure future financial stability for loved family members.

Attorneys operate on a contingency fee, which means they don't charge for their services upfront. They are paid a proportion of the compensation awarded by a settlement or jury verdict. This arrangement ensures that the victim receives the entire amount of money they deserve.

Lawyers specializing in mesothelioma have access to extensive industry resources, including asbestos-specific databases and the records of asbestos-contaminated workplaces. They can look into possible causes of asbestos exposure in a patient and determine how their condition could have been prevented.

The asbestos industry was aware for a long time about asbestos' dangers however, it did not warn workers or consumers. Mesothelioma posed a serious risk to workers in the manufacturing, construction shipyards, power plants and other industrial positions. These include miners, factory workers asbestos insulation producers and installers, railroad and automotive employees, plumbers, and construction crews.

Asbestos victims may file lawsuits against these companies for negligence or failure to warn, resulting in substantial compensation. This money can cover medical expenses as well as debts, loss of income, funeral costs and funeral expenses. In addition, it can enhance the quality of a victim's life and provide hope for the future.

They provide a free case Evaluation

When a person or family is diagnosed with mesothelioma, they are often faced with a myriad of questions about their case and how it could affect them financially. Attorneys who specialize in mesothelioma will help patients understand their legal options and make the process as simple as is possible.

Mesothelioma attorneys can help patients and their families determine the extent of exposure to asbestos and the effects the exposure affected their lives. They will also help them identify possible sources of compensation. Asbestos victims may be qualified for compensation to cover their past and ongoing medical expenses, loss of income, emotional distress, and more.

Attorneys who specialize in mesothelioma are skilled at gathering and reviewing important evidence like medical records, work histories, test results as well as asbestos exposure locations and many other aspects. Additionally, they have the resources and connections to employ industrial hygienists and medical experts to assist in constructing their cases. Asbestos lawyers also make lawsuits on behalf of their clients and negotiate settlements for mesothelioma and will take cases to court as required.

In addition to filing personal injury or wrongful death lawsuits, mesothelioma lawyers can also make claims against asbestos trust funds. Asbestos bankruptcy trusts were set by businesses that were responsible for exposing workers to asbestos, and submitting a claim to one of these trusts is a fantastic method of obtaining financial compensation.

Mesothelioma law firms are adept in handling mesothelioma cases with complexities, and they will ensure that your claim is filed within the prescribed time of limitations. They will also handle all litigation so that you can focus on getting better.

Attorneys who specialize in mesothelioma can provide an initial mesothelioma assessment for free to help patients and their families find the right mesothelioma lawyers for their case. These attorneys are dedicated to ensuring that mesothelioma patients and their families receive the highest possible compensation. They will work on a contingency basis, meaning they only collect fees if they win their client's case. This allows the victims and their loved ones to focus their attention on their health and recovery knowing that their mesothelioma lawyers are doing everything they can to secure the justice they deserve.

They are a part of the practice throughout the country.

Mesothelioma is a form of asbestos cancer that affects the protective lining that surrounds vital organs such as the lungs. Asbestos lawyers have a track record of suing asbestos firms responsible for this deadly illness. The law firms are committed to ensuring that victims and their families the compensation they are due.

asbestos lawsuit lawyers provide free case evaluations and they operate on a contingent basis. This means that they will only be paid if their client receives compensation. This method is geared towards the best interests of the victims and helps them receive the highest settlement for mesothelioma possible.

Companies that specialize in mesothelioma can access a wealth of resources, including asbestos-specific databases. These databases assist in determining the patients' exposure source. They also are aware of the specific professions and industries with high-risk that could have exposed people to the dangerous substance. They can then put together a strong case against the responsible parties to get compensation for their client.

The lawyers they work with help their clients recover out of pocket expenses and VA benefits, in addition to bringing lawsuits and filing mesothelioma claims. They know how to determine the value of a victim's damages and negotiate with insurance companies to maximize compensation.

Many asbestos companies responsible for mesothelioma, asbestosis and other asbestos-related diseases have been bankrupted. They have established trust funds to compensate victims.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ist their clients in submitting a bankruptcy claim to these trusts.

The aim of asbestos law firms is to make the legal process as stress-free as they can for their clients. They keep their clients informed throughout the process, and are ready to take their case to court in order to protect their client's rights.

In a mesothelioma-related case lawyers will prepare and present the evidence to prove that asbestos exposure caused the illness of each client. This involves presenting medical records, research studies and other data to prove the asbestos company responsible. They will argue that asbestos companies knew of the dangers, but kept the information secret, putting the health of their customers in danger.

They travel to meet their Clients

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er has the resources to meet with their clients to discuss their asbestos exposure, create an effective case, and file it in the right jurisdiction. Certain states have different laws that govern when a lawsuit can be filed. Others have courtrooms that are more favourable for these cases. Attorneys should also be aware of local resources for expert witnesses, such as industrial hygienists or medical experts.

Mesothelioma lawyers must collect crucial evidence to prove the extent of exposure to asbestos and the severity of their symptoms. This can include medical records, lab tests as well as employment history, compensation claims, along with other employment and financial documents. The mesothelioma lawyers will also be in a position to assist clients in filing VA disability claims.

In the United States, asbestos is utilized in a variety of products. Due to asbestos' cheapness and durability, as well as its fire-resistant qualities it was a sought-after material in a variety of industries. Unfortunately, asbestos attorneys companies were aware of the dangers of exposure but hid this information. Asbestos victims are entitled to compensation for the harm they suffered.

Many asbestos companies were subject to numerous lawsuits from victims and were forced to go bankrupt. In order to pay victims, these companies set up bankruptcy trusts.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ist clients claim from these trusts by explaining where they were exposed and which manufacturers were responsible for their exposure.

A mesothelioma suit can also seek compensatory damages for a victim's losses, such as lost income, medical bills as well as the loss of a loved one. A mesothelioma suit may also include a wrongful death claim for a loved one who has passed away due to the disease.

The most effective mesothelioma lawyers are on a contingency basis and are able to prioritize their clients' needs. They offer free case evaluations as they understand the financial hardships that accompany the diagnosis of mesothelioma. These benefits allow patients and their families to get top-quality legal representation.
